ETL (Extract, Transform, Load) and ELT (Extract, Load, Transform) are two processes used for integrating and transforming data, but they have different approaches. Think of it like cooking a meal — ETL is like preparing and chopping all the ingredients before cooking, while ELT is like cooking the ingredients first and then adding spices and seasonings to taste.

The key difference is that in ETL, data is transformed before being loaded into a data warehouse, whereas in ELT, the raw data is loaded into the warehouse first and then transformed using SQL or other data transformation tools.

Both ETL and ELT have their own advantages and disadvantages.

  • Personally, I prefer ELT over ETL because it’s more flexible and makes it easier to store new, unstructured data. With ELT, you can save any type of information without having to transform and structure it first, which gives you immediate access to all your information.
  • ELT is faster than ETL when it comes to data availability. With ELT, all the data can be immediately loaded into the system, and users can then decide which data they want to transform and analyze.
